Drunk Man Falls Into Creek, Found Dead

A drunk man was found dead floating in a creek along Purok 7, Feria St., Barangay Calinan Poblacion, Calinan District, Davao City.

The victim was identified as 52-year-old Edgardo Antoc, also known as ‘Tata.’

In an exclusive interview with Bombo Radyo Davao, Eduardo Antoc, the victim’s brother, stated that the victim had gone to a drinking session the night before.

According to Antoc, their neighbor was celebrating a wedding, so his brother stayed to drink with other guests.

By dawn, Eduardo searched for his brother but could not find him at the gathering.

He initially thought the victim had simply fallen asleep somewhere, but he was nowhere to be found.

This morning, a resident spotted the victim’s body floating in the creek and immediately alerted authorities.

The victim’s family hopes that no foul play is involved, and authorities currently believe it was an accident.

According to Raymond Ramos, a resident in the area, he heard a commotion around 5 a.m., prompting him to call the authorities.

Police are still investigating the incident to determine if other factors contributed to the victim’s death.

The remains of Edgardo Antoc are now at a funeral home while authorities await further investigation results to confirm the exact cause of death.
